an•gi•o•ma
Pronunciation: (an"jē-ō'mu), [key]—
n.,
—pl. -mas, -ma•taPronunciation: (-mu-tu). [key]
Pathol.
a benign tumor consisting chiefly of dilated or newly formed blood vessels
(hemangioma) or lymph vessels
(lymphangioma). Random House Unabridged Dictionary, Copyright © 1997, by Random House, Inc., on Infoplease.
